== Latin == === Etymology === Frequentative from ab- (“from, away from”) +‎ nūtō (“nod”). === Pronunciation === (Classical Latin) IPA(key): [abˈnuː.toː] (modern Italianate Ecclesiastical) IPA(key): [abˈnuː.to] === Verb === abnūtō (present infinitive abnūtāre, perfect active abnūtāvī); first conjugation, no passive, no supine stem to deny often (by a nod); refuse ==== Conjugation ==== ==== Related terms ==== abnuō adnuō nūtō === References === “abnuto”, in Charlton T. Lewis and Charles Short (1879), A Latin Dictionary, Oxford: Clarendon Press “abnuto”, in Charlton T. Lewis (1891), An Elementary Latin Dictionary, New York: Harper & Brothers “abnuto”, in Gaffiot, Félix (1934), Dictionnaire illustré latin-français, Hachette.
